David Bomberg, Sappers Under Hill 60, c. 1918-19

David Bomberg

Sappers Under Hill 60, c. 1918-19
pencil, ink and wash on paper
12 x 16 cm

Bomberg was commissioned in 1917 by the Canadian War Memorials Fund to commemorate an incident in which a company of Canadian soldiers dug tunnels under the German trenches to lay explosives for a surprise assault on the enemy defences at Ypres, in France. He produced a series of drawings showing the complex structures of struts, girders and pulleys that formed part of the underground environment. Here, his tiny figures are dwarfed by these dominant structures.
